According to The vanguard news .. A’Ibom Assembly defies Court order, passes bill to end rotational headship. Even with the Court Order stopping Akwa Ibom State House of Assembly from passing the bill for a law to end rotational headship of the state Traditional Rulers Council (TRC) to allow permanent headship by the majority Ibibio ethnic group in the state. The State’s 8th House on Friday passed the Bill for a law to amend the Traditional Rulers Law, Cap. 155 Laws of Akwa Ibom State, 2023 (HAB 316) against the disapproval by the people of Annangs, Akwa Ibom second largest ethnic group who had sought the restraining order from the State High Court presided over by Justice Ntong Ntong. The State Legislature passed the Bill after members representing Etim Ekpo/Ika State Constituency, and Chairman, House Committee on Local Government and Chieftaincy Affairs, Mr Mfon Idung submitted the committee’s report on the floor of the House.  ‘I will resurrect Mohbad if allowed to see body’ – cleric claims in viral video A self-proclaimed cleric named Oba Ewulomi has claimed that he possesses the ability to bring the late Nigerian singer Ilerioluwa Oladimeji Aloba, aka Mohbad, back to life. In a recently shared Facebook video, Ewulomi, who spoke in English and Yoruba, declared that he holds the power to resurrect Mohbad. His words, “Promise Imole Mohbad can still live again. Whether you have faith or not, I am not concerned. “But that boy can wake up again. Let me see the corpse of the boy. Give me access to the boy’s corpse. If truly my almighty father replies in fire, on water, in the wind, and on land, that boy will wake up again.” The cleric, however, failed to disclose details of his ministry on social media. Recall that the late singer died on September 12 in controversial circumstances and was buried the following day. However, the police exhumed his remains last Thursday for an autopsy and are awaiting results.

FROM THE POLICE HEADQUARTERS THIS MORNING  Reported by our Uyo Correspondence: Abraham Timothy It was end of the road on Tuesday for two robbery gang members who robbed Uyo residents at Udoette by School Road, Ikot Udoro and its environs, as they met their waterloo in a gun battle with the Police. Another member of the gang, one Godswill Ntieno Isaac, was however lucky to have been picked up alive. Akwa Ibom State Commissioner of Police, Mr. Olatoye Durosinmi announced this today in a statement signed by the Police Public Relations Officer, Mr. Odiko Macdon. He said the Police were responding to a distress call at about 1:50am, last Tuesday when operatives of Quick Intervention Unit proceeded to the scene and on sighting the Police, the hoodlums engaged them in a gun duel. The Police chief said items recovered from the criminals include, 4 Locally made Pistols, 15 Live Cartridges, 2 Expanded Cartridges and one Iron Cutter. Corruption is The major reasons for poverty in Nigeria  The Nigerian economy is one of the largest in Africa and is primarily driven by oil exports. However, it is also diversified with sectors such as agriculture, telecommunications, banking, manufacturing, and services contributing to its growth. Nigeria has faced various economic challenges, including a heavy reliance on oil revenue, corruption, inadequate infrastructure, and high unemployment rates. These factors have hindered the country's economic development and contributed to income inequality. Nigeria Corruption perception index In recent years, the Nigerian government has made efforts to diversify the economy, improve infrastructure, and attract foreign investment. Initiatives such as the Economic Recovery and Growth Plan (ERGP) have been implemented to address these challenges and promote sustainable economic growth.
